Platform Evolution Shapes Market Perception

Robinhood Markets, Inc. is a United States-based financial technology company that provides a commission-free brokerage platform accessible through mobile and web applications. Established with the objective of simplifying financial market participation, the platform offers access to equities, options, and digital assets through an intuitive user interface. Its streamlined design and accessibility have positioned Robinhood as a key participant in modern brokerage services, particularly within digitally native financial ecosystems. This platform-centric model emphasizes user engagement, transaction simplicity, and broad accessibility across financial markets.

Brokerage Model Drives Competitive Position

Robinhood Markets differentiates itself through a commission-free trading model combined with a simplified user experience. This approach has reshaped traditional brokerage frameworks by reducing barriers to entry and enhancing accessibility. The platform’s integration of financial tools, educational resources, and real-time data contributes to its appeal among a diverse user base. By prioritizing usability and accessibility, Robinhood has established a distinct position within the financial services landscape, competing with both traditional brokerages and emerging fintech platforms.
